Abstract

A method for inspecting a display device (which includes a pixel electrode and a touch sensor overlapping the pixel electrode) includes: adjusting an impedance value of a variable impedance circuit of an inspection apparatus according to a model of the display device; driving a power source generator of the inspection apparatus; supplying a pixel voltage to the pixel electrode through an output terminal connected to the variable impedance circuit; driving the touch sensor; and detecting a defect related to the pixel electrode based on sensing signals output from the touch sensor.
